Read review for details good product
This is a good product I used it on a custom application so I gave it 3 stars for install looks simple enough the intended way you’d install it. Ease of use also got 3 stars I can see confusion installing it for someone that’s not well versed in tensioners and how they operate (recommend printing out instructions CNCMOTOK). Also 3 stars for value, it’s not cheap junk but not exactly the quality I expect either in very neutral on the value/quality. Overall 4 stars like mentioned above not horrible not amazing dead middle. I will mention it is waaay larger in person than photos make it out to be, rollers as large if not larger than a half dollar (American) overall sized I’d say roughly about if not a little larger than the average males palm and the rollers are about the width of an iPhone 12/13 screen keep that in mind if you’re tight on room with your build.
